Logistics Game: Speed and Reliability
Shipping times can make or break an international shopping experience. While AliExpress sellers often promise 15-30 day delivery (that somehow stretches to 45+), Pandabuy Spreadsheet shipping options are consistently faster and more reliable.
Here’s the tea: Pandabuy consolidates packages from multiple Chinese suppliers, which means you can order from ten different Taobao shops and get everything in one shipment. My average delivery time has been 12-18 days compared to AliExpress’s 25-40 days. Plus, their tracking is actually accurate – no more staring at “departed from facility” for three weeks straight.
Safety First: Payment and Product Protection
Security in online shopping isn’t just about payment protection – it’s about getting what you paid for. While both platforms offer buyer protection, Pandabuy Spreadsheet quality control happens before your items even leave China.
I’ve had too many AliExpress orders arrive looking nothing like the product photos. With Pandabuy, agents physically inspect your items, test functionality, and provide actual evidence before shipping. Their payment system is also more secure since funds are held until you approve the QC photos. No more fighting for refunds after receiving counterfeit or damaged goods.
